Source: Bureau of Meteorology
For people in parts of Wide Bay and Burnett, Darling Downs and
Granite Belt and Southeast Coast Forecast Districts.
Issued at 8:16 pm Thursday, 9 December 2021.
Severe thunderstorms over the southeast.
Weather Situation: Thunderstorms are occurring in a moist and
unstable air mass along and east of a surface trough that is
currently located over the interior of the state.
Severe thunderstorms are likely to produce heavy rainfall that may
lead to flash flooding in the warning area over the next several
hours. Locations which may be affected include Brisbane,
Maroochydore, Kingaroy, Caboolture, Cherbourg and Redcliffe.
Severe thunderstorms are no longer occurring in the North Tropical
Coast and Tablelands, Northern Goldfields and Upper Flinders and
Herbert and Lower Burdekin districts and the warning for these
districts is CANCELLED.
3-4cm hail was recorded around Goondiwindi earlier this
afternoon.
61mm in 1 hour at Samford Village.
41mm in 30 minutes recorded at Spring Mountain
